“…Eu is especially significant for tracing sediment provenance because it is the only element among the REEs that can exist stably in a divalent state (Mason & Moore, ). A negative Eu anomaly (measured by Eu/Eu * which is a value less than 1.0) results from incorporation of Eu in Ca‐plagioclase (Mason & Moore, ); it is a widely used index for tracing sediment provenance (Hu & Yang, ; Liu & Yang, , ; Muhs, Budahn, et al, ; Muhs, ). Rb substitutes for K in the major rock‐forming minerals, based upon the principles of element substitution (Mason & Moore, ).…”

“…The precise significance of sedimentary records for environmental evolution cannot be fully determined without knowledge of sediment provenance (Muhs et al, ; Thomas, ). Furthermore, the identification of different source‐sink linkages for sandy sediments could lead to very different interpretations of regional sedimentary sequences (Hu & Yang, ). For example, the sand in desert marginal sequences may indicate a humid environment with direct sediment input from sandy alluvium and colluvium eroded from the uplands (Williams, ), whereas sands in the interior of deserts may indicate an arid environment with aeolian sediment input from desert dunes (Yang, Preusser, et al, ).…”
